Christmas Pop Quiz

Which Christmas movie is this from?
Which Christmas movie is this from?
Choose the right answer:
Option A Home Alone
Option B The Santa Clause
Option C National Lampoon's: Christmas Vacation
Option D Die Hard
 Makeupdiva posted over a year ago
skip question >>
save